1. Ce site utilise des cookies. En continuant à utiliser ce site, vous acceptez l'utilisation des cookies. En savoir plus.

macro

Discussion dans 'Fanuc' créé par at93100, 2 Décembre 2011.

  1. at93100

    at93100 Nouveau

    Messages:
    26
    Inscrit:
    16 Juin 2011
    Localité:
    montreuil
    macro
    bonjour a tous
    voila j'expose mon problème j'ai un 24 pans a usiner sur un tour nakamura bi-broche bi-tourelle armoire 31i
    je voudrais simplifier la programmation en utilisant un sous programme qui me fera 23 répétitions avec l'utilisation de l'axe C en incrémentale c'est a dire l'axe H
    merci pour vos réponses .
     
  2. yann38

    yann38 Nouveau

    Messages:
    13
    Inscrit:
    14 Octobre 2011
  3. yann38

    yann38 Nouveau

    Messages:
    13
    Inscrit:
    14 Octobre 2011
    macro
    autre question tu veux fraiser comme l'exemple si dessous (c'est du six pans 50 mm) avec ton axe C ?


    T1111(FRAISE Ø20)
    G54
    G98M41
    G40G113
    M98 P9000
    G97 S800 M3
    G0 X90 Z-10 M8
    G112
    G98 G1 X86.6 C0 F100
    G1 X43.3 C37.5
    G1X-43.3
    G1 X-86.6 C0
    G1 X-43.3 C-37.5
    G1 X43.3
    G1 X86.6 C0
    G113
    M41
    G0 X200 Z50 M9
    M5
     
  4. THOMAS Jacques

    THOMAS Jacques Apprenti

    Messages:
    59
    Inscrit:
    17 Mai 2011
    Localité:
    isere
  5. JLuc69

    JLuc69 Compagnon

    Messages:
    1 155
    Inscrit:
    19 Juin 2008
    Localité:
    Genas (69)
    macro
    Ci dessous, une solution paramètrée (à adapter) :
    Code:
    (prog principal)
    ...
    ...
    (APPEL PROG. 1 SUR -D200 -PROF.20 -24PANS -AVANCE100MM/MN)
    G65 P1 X200 Z-20 K24 F100
    ...
    ...
    M30
    
    O0001(REALISATIONS DE PANS)
    IF[#6EQ0]THEN#6=6(SI ON OUBLIE LE NBR DE PANS PAR DEFAUT 6PANS)
    #100=360/#6(INCREMENT ANGLE)
    #101=0(ANGLE DEPART)
    G98(MODE AVANCE MM/MN)
    G0X[#24+30.]Z[#26+5.]
    Z#26
    G1G42X#24C0F#9
    N1#101=#101+#100(INCREMENTATION DE ANGLE)
    X#24C#101
    IF[#101LT360]GOTO1
    G0G40X[#24+30.]
    Z[#26+5.]
    G99(MODE AVANCE MM/TR)
    M99
    
    Attention, ce programme n'est pas testé, mais normalement il devrait passer "finger in the noze"
    A toi d'adapter si tu veux travailler "à gauche" (G41).
    J'ai mis une approche de 30mm en X et 5mm en Z : à toi de voir si ça te convient
    Je part du principe que tu commences à C0, adapte si tu veux commencer à un angle différent (G65....A30..) et gerer le #1 dans le sous programme
     
  6. at93100

    at93100 Nouveau

    Messages:
    26
    Inscrit:
    16 Juin 2011
    Localité:
    montreuil
    macro
    bonjour
    merci a tous pour vos reponse ,finalement j'ai reussi a me debrouiller avec un sous programme que j'appel plusieur fois avec la fonction L (M98P22 L43)
    plus l'incrementation de l'axe C 'c'est a dire H .
    en tout cas merci pour votre aide c'est sympa
    en esperant vous soliciter prochainement je vous salut cordialement
     
Chargement...
Articles en relation
  1. haja130
    Réponses:
    8
    Affichages:
    829
  2. Dodo86
    Réponses:
    1
    Affichages:
    679
  3. scotjh
    Réponses:
    5
    Affichages:
    831
  4. tiguen
    Réponses:
    9
    Affichages:
    1 504
  5. raphaelm
    Réponses:
    5
    Affichages:
    1 307

Partager cette page